//go:build docker
// +build docker
package command
import (
"fmt"
"os"
"os/exec"
"strconv"
"strings"
"github.com/shellhub-io/shellhub/agent/pkg/osauth"
)
// statFn is a seam for os.Stat used when probing /proc/1/ns/* entries.
// It can be replaced in tests to avoid filesystem access.
var statFn = os.Stat
// nsenterArgs builds the nsenter flag slice from the present namespace map.
// Docker always shares the host time namespace, so -T is never passed.
func nsenterArgs(present map[string]string) []string {
args := []string{}
for _, flag := range present {
args = append(args, flag)
}
return args
}
// CheckCredentialSwitch is a no-op in Docker mode: the agent relies on
// nsenter+setpriv for credential switching, so this check is not applicable.
func CheckCredentialSwitch() error {
return nil
}
func NewCmd(u *osauth.User, shell, term, host string, envs []string, command ...string) *exec.Cmd {
groups, err := osauth.ListGroups(u.Username)
if err != nil {
groups = []uint32{}
}
// NOTE: Wrap the command with nsenter and setpriv to run it inside the
// host's namespaces with the correct user and groups. This is necessary
// because the agent is running inside a Docker container and we want to
// execute the command in the host's context.
nscommand, _ := nsenterCommandWrapper(u.UID, u.GID, groups, u.HomeDir, command...)
cmd := exec.Command(nscommand[0], nscommand[1:]...) //nolint:gosec
// TODO: There are other environment variables we could set like SSH_CONNECTION, SSH_TTY, SSH_ORIGINAL_COMMAND, etc.
// We need to check which ones are relevant and set them accordingly.
// https://en.wikibooks.org/wiki/OpenSSH/Client_Applications
cmd.Env = []string{
"TERM=" + term,
"HOME=" + u.HomeDir,
"SHELL=" + shell,
"USER=" + u.Username,
"LOGNAME=" + u.Username,
"SHELLHUB_HOST=" + host,
// NOTE: We need to set the SSH_CLIENT because some applications (like bash) check for it to enable some
// features or load some files (like .bashrc). Currently, we don't have this information, so we set a fake one.
// TODO: Set the real SSH_CLIENT value.
// Format: "<ip> <source-port> <destination-port>"
// https://en.wikibooks.org/wiki/OpenSSH/Client_Applications
"SSH_CLIENT=127.0.0.1 0 0",
}
cmd.Env = append(cmd.Env, envs...)
return cmd
}
func getWrappedCommand(nsArgs []string, uid, gid uint32, groups []uint32, home string) []string {
gids := []string{}
for _, g := range groups {
gids = append(gids, strconv.Itoa(int(g)))
}
setPrivCmd := []string{
"/bin/setpriv",
fmt.Sprintf("--groups=%s", strings.Join(gids, ",")),
"--ruid",
strconv.Itoa(int(uid)),
"--regid",
strconv.Itoa(int(gid)),
}
nsenterCmd := append([]string{
"/usr/bin/nsenter",
"-t",
"1",
}, nsArgs...)
nsenterCmd = append(
nsenterCmd,
[]string{
"-S",
strconv.Itoa(int(uid)),
fmt.Sprintf("--wdns=%s", home),
}...,
)
return append(setPrivCmd, nsenterCmd...)
}
// nsenterCommandWrapper builds the full nsenter+setpriv command slice.
// It probes /proc/1/ns/* for each namespace using statFn, then delegates
// flag assembly to nsenterArgs. The time namespace is never joined because
// Docker always shares the host time namespace.
func nsenterCommandWrapper(uid, gid uint32, groups []uint32, home string, command ...string) ([]string, error) {
if _, err := statFn("/usr/bin/nsenter"); err != nil && !os.IsNotExist(err) {
return nil, err
}
namespaces := map[string]string{
"mnt": "-m",
"uts": "-u",
"ipc": "-i",
"net": "-n",
"pid": "-p",
"cgroup": "-C",
}
present := map[string]string{}
for ns, flag := range namespaces {
if _, err := statFn(fmt.Sprintf("/proc/1/ns/%s", ns)); err != nil {
continue
}
present[ns] = flag
}
args := nsenterArgs(present)
return append(getWrappedCommand(args, uid, gid, groups, home), command...), nil
}
// SFTPServerCommand creates the command used by agent to start the SFTP server used in a SFTP connection.
func SFTPServerCommand() *exec.Cmd {
return exec.Command("/proc/self/exe", []string{"sftp", string(SFTPServerModeDocker)}...) //nolint:gosec
}
